Post A Job
Jobs By Company
Keyword or Job ID
SOC Design Validation Manager
Job Opportunity at
Samaritan Technical Professional
Posted on Mar 19
This individual will be responsible for leading a team spread across multiple locations and countries. Working with technical leads to implement and maintain advanced validation methodologies and lead projects with varying environments, microcontroller cores, peripheral sets, and target application uses. Our wireless solutions group implements a variety of embedded peripherals and cores ranging from ARM, MIPS, and 8051 to dedicated Co-Application processors and DSPs. We also work within a variety of wireless technologies like Bluetooth, WiFi, Zigbee, Lora, etc.
Key Responsibilities include but are not limited to:
Work with Silicon development, pre-silicon verification, architecture, applications, and product/test teams to understand SOC macro system requirements, Wireless Module requirements, then develop comprehensive SOC and macro (peripheral) level validation plans. The candidate must manage multiple project pipelines and allocating resources accordingly. Assist in determining resource requirements, such as staffing levels, licenses, tools/equipment, lab management, equipment budgeting, calibration cycles, vendor negotiations/contracts, and other resources or assets available to the candidate.
Technical contributions will include helping define and develop test benches, test suite architecture and environment. Requirements development, scheduling and process flows, and to automated test case regressions to ensure code stability and compatibility over multiple projects. In addition to effective management of our code base and plans; the candidate must possess a strong knowledge of C, Python, LabVIEW, and Test Stand knowledge. Other scripting languages, automation, and user-level experience is a plus.
The candidate should be well versed in:
Macro and SOC-level Validation
Embedded C Programming & Lab Equipment Automation
Able to develop effective functional test cases, coverage analysis and requirement traceability
Develop sound structural and functional code at both the macro and system level test suites
Develop scripts to automate validation process & analysis
Provide guidance and support during validation development activities for all team members
Guide development of PCBs for Validation Hardware and Emulation Platforms
Work well within a cross functional team of varying skillsets.
Provide feedback and review of validation activities across the WSG division
Define and develop validation process improvements and methodologies as part of continuous improvement
Support debug silicon issues & assist in pre-silicon root causing
Support sustaining efforts from incoming field, internal, and other customer requests
Bachelor's degree in Electrical Engineering and a minimum of 12 years' industry experience. MSEE preferred.
Good understanding of Microcontroller architecture and products.
Expertise in C programming, Python, LabView, and TestStand.
Pre-silicon experience with Verilog, System Verilog is preferred.
Other scripting language knowledge: PERL/TCL is a plus.
Expertise in digital and analog validation, Lab equipment usage and bench automation is required.
Expertise in Macro level and System level validation is required.
Expertise in writing reusable C-based validation code and test bench architecture is required.
Knowledge of Makefile development for build time configurability of code is a plus.
Very good understanding of Object Oriented Programming concepts is preferred.
Able to write tests Assembly code to verify certain specific SoC functionality.
Able to define validation process documentation, Flows and Review validation processes.
Strong analytical, and problem-solving skills, as well as hands-on SoC debugging and bring-up skills is required.
Able to set team goals and work consistently towards achieving them.
Excellent verbal, written and presentation skills.
Electrical Engineering Degrees
Terms of Usage
ElectricalEngineer.com is owned, operated, and copyrighted by Career Marketplace (© 2002-2019, All Rights Reserved)